T h e B i r t h day G i f t L h a v a n y a D h a r m a l i n g a m

Bell and Octavia scrambled up the hill behind the abandoned mall. “Anneh, wait for me!” panted Octavia. The short climb was already taxing her fragile lungs. And the N95 mask was not helping. The midday sun beat down ferociously on them; temperatures well in the high 30s. But she had been waiting weeks for her birthday present. She wasn’t giving up now! Bell slowed reluctantly, nervously tugging the brim of his cap further down. Octavia had pressured him for weeks to take her to see the ‘small jungle’ that he and his friends curi-curi sometimes went to lepak at. She had never been out of the house in the short 6 years of her life apart from hospital visits in specially insulated and filtered taxis. COVID-19, TrinCov and Virus X were rampant. She caught up, huffing and panting furiously, whatever tiny bit of her face visible above the N95 mask, furrowed in determination. “It’s okay anneh, no one is around. I’ll be fine!” she promised, tugging on his sleeve. Her earnestness and puppy eyes could make even a rock melt.
